Glenn Morris wrote:
> Mike Kupfer wrote:
>
>> Also, and less important, I got the impression from the discussion on
>> emacs-devel that this feature was partially introduced in Emacs 25.
>> Wasn't the change in 26.1 just to make .tar.gz and .tgz behave the same?
>
> Yes, .tar.gz is extracted in eg Emacs 25.3 but tgz isn't.
And indeed NEWS.25 says "The command 'dired-do-compress', bound to 'Z',
now can compress directories", so NEWS.26 is duplicating that.
